Output 4d88286a9db448b78099317838282054b075b6773c84768aaf38f93d139c1eeb:15

value
2453690
script pubkey
OP_0 OP_PUSHBYTES_20 3fffc84482d815bb2b1ab9a195b2beaa387e9fc4
address
bc1q8llus3yzmq2mk2c6hxsetv474gu8a87yee8zwq
transaction
4d88286a9db448b78099317838282054b075b6773c84768aaf38f93d139c1eeb
confirmations
245105
spent
true